Very Good (covers nice; contents clean & tight); tiny tears, nicks & creases ($18.95 price present of front flap, small rubbed spot top corner of front cover) d/j. 8vo., black boards in dust jacket; 355 pages First Edition, first printing. Unique signed presentation on the front endpaper, to "The Tonight Show" cohost Ed McMahon, who wrote the book's introduction: "Dear Ed, Your help and kindness were simply gorgeous. Nobody but you could have been as appropriate to introduce this book. So many thanks, Guy Lebow." Also, laid in is an autograph letter from LeBow to McMahon, on WNWK (New York) stationery: "Dear Ed. Here it is. Hope you like it. My deepest thanks to you, Guy." An autobiography of an early media and television pioneer. LeBow [who died in 2008 at age 92] was a sportscaster, newsman, musician, author, producer and TV personality, who was deeply involved in community educational and recreational programs for children and adults in New York City and Newark. Ed McMahon [1923-2009] was an American announcer, game show host, comedian, actor, singer, and combat aviator. McMahon and Johnny Carson began their association in their first TV series, the ABC game show Who Do You Trust?, running from 1957 to 1962. McMahon is best known for his 30-year run (1962-1992) as cohost to Johnny Carson on NBC's "The Tonight Show," Probably one of the best association copies you can have of this title!.
